9i - 40 degrees
Pw, 45 degrees
Gw 50 degrees
Sw 54 degrees
Lw 60 degrees

The lofts are a good club and a half stronger than the Titleist DCI irons I had as a junior and half a club longer than my last set, this is where people think they're getting longer because that number on the bottom goes down but they're not realising that a 9 iron is more like an old 8iron

My Callaway XR 9 and PW are 30° and 44° respectively
Then I have Cleveland RTX 2.0 CB Gap Wedge and Sand Wedge at 51° and 56° respectively.
The lofts on most irons sets now are so strong you have to know them to ensure you get the right gap wedge.
